KevinG Posted January 15, 2023 Share Posted January 15, 2023 The upper control arm bracket came welded on just two sides. The part that I'm holding towards the camera is actually the bottom/back of the bracket and doesn't quite reach the tube, so it isn't welded. In fact, I think you can see where the weld stops near my thumb. I think it just got enough fatigue that it finally gave out. I'm pretty sure it happened on the highway on the way to AZ. Like I said before, part of me wishes I would have waited for DT or spent a little more on Curries, but at the time I literally bought these and my tires at the same time, and the axles arrived first. The availability is awesome. The brakes are massive and pads are easy to come by if needed, the wheel speed sensors were there and were not any drama. I was able to use my steering from my PR44 and just swap it over. The bad: I got "talked" in to E lockers which never worked out well for me, but that's definitely on me for letting someone sell me on them. Even this bracket thing is on me since it's all over the internet that it's a known thing with them, and had I been smarter I would have had someone with more experience (Byron lol) take a better look at them to see I needed to address it before I put them in. 1 Link to comment

Na, that’s what I get for not listening to my gut. I needed the axles now and they were available at a good price. So, let’s list what I have fixed or modify. · Cut and rewelded rear track bar for clearance. · Cut off all rear brackets for Evo LA. · Blew the rear locker and gears out and had to replace every seal and bearing in the rear. · Pulled both E lockers and went to ARB. That was the best decision I made with these axles. · Cut off front upper arm mount and replaced with Currie Joint since the UD were fucking toast within the first year. · Broke the front track bar. · Broke the front track bar again completely. · And now I need to service my hubs. Pulling out front tomorrow to cut off track bar, lower control arm mounts, and shock mounts. I am going to widen the shock mounts as far as I can for a better coil over angle. Got a new Synergy weld on trackbar mount for ram, and will probably cut off the coil buckets and fab new bump stops. But yeah, on paper they were the biggest and strongest axles out there at the time LOL. The list of broken shit has passed the non-broken shit. 1 1 Link to comment
